>>Well I have been given permission to announce that Grand Master Alex Yermolinsky
>>will play a match of six games in early June against Hiarcs 7 running on my PPC
>>G3 233 MHZ computer. The match will be 6 games played at tournament/match level
>>conditions (i.e., 40/2 60/game) and will played sometime between June 2-10 of
>>this year. Sorry about the delay in announcing this match. Final details have
>>not been formalized, yet Mr. Yermolinsky and I have shown an eagerness to
>>conduct the match pending final logistical arrangements. Financial details will
>>not be revealed unless Mr. Yermolinsky agrees to that information being
>>provided.
>>
>>I am excited about this opportunity to gather data on the level of chess playing
>>computers vs. strong GMs.
